I'm sure Dr. Bermant is an excellent surgeon, but you seem a bit overly impressed.

He simply stands out at this particular site because of his large volumes of posts. While some of them are somewhat helpful, most of them are just shameless self-promotion. I have nothing against him though, as he has certainly helped many of the gyne sufferers here.

Many other competent surgeons have developed excellent techniques, and many handle more gyne cases per year than even Dr. Bermant. For example, my PS, Dr. Lista, handles about 150 gyne surgeries per year, and has developed a special technique where he can extract glandular tissue through the lipo incision... negating the need for the "peri-areolar" incision which can lead to visible scarring.

Another competent surgeon around these parts is Dr. Fielding, and has received excellent reviews from members of this site.

Both of these PS's I mention are well aware of this board, but stay away from it, unlike Dr. Bermant.

Dr. Fielding thinks that this site is "our domain", and he has no place being here. I can understand and respect his reasoning.

Dr. Lista is simply too busy to be browsing through these forums, but does support this site through a paid listing. He has also presented his technique for gyne surgery at PS conferences and meetings.

Anyway my point is, I think the guy is a great surgeon, but you are giving him way too much credit.

Each surgeon has their own skills and techniques.  Surgery is an artform, not just using a specific method.  My Dynamic Technique is an evoluation of an approach to the many forms of gynecomastia deformity I have seen over the years.

Yes there are a number of meetings held all over the world for doctors to exchange ideas, learn new techniques, and review details.  Some of the better medical societies actually have requirements for continuing education to remain active members.  

I attend a number of meetings each year both to learn and exchange ideas.  I have lectured, given courses, and had informal exchanges with my peers about details of plastic surgery.  I can ask someone in person about something in the literature or my own findings.  I also get approached about what I am doing, why, how, and other details.  This is how medicine advances, checks itself, and evolves.  

Specialties even cross educate each other.  I have recently been invited to present my Gynecomastia Male Chest Scupture for one of the major Endocrinology Society Meetings.
